Latest Patents
Fiore's latest patents include a groundbreaking method for chip design that facilitates permanent external electrical connections to active circuitry in semiconductor structures. His first patent, titled "Chip design process for wire bond and flip-chip package," introduces a fabrication method whereby electrical connection can be established using either a wire bond pad or a metal bump formed on the semiconductor substrate. A critical feature of this innovation involves a final metallization layer that connects with active circuitry, with layers of insulating material strategically applied to protect and expose necessary components for optimal electrical connection.
The second patent, named "Consolidated chip design for wire bond and flip-chip package technologies," mirrors the advancements noted in his first patent but emphasizes the seamless connectivity required for modern semiconductor applications. Both patents provide solutions for testing and burning in semiconductor dies without the risk of direct contact with the testing device, showcasing their practicality and applicability in real-world scenarios.
